James Michael Mason Jr., a cherished father, brother, and friend, passed away on July 4th, 2024, after a two-year battle with cancer. Born on August 11, 1962, in Marion, Ohio, to Ruby Lee and James Michael Mason Sr., James spent his entire life in the community he loved. James attended Harding High School and later built a distinguished career at Marion Correctional Institution where he worked for over 20 years. His dedication and hard work continued as he transitioned to managing fast food restaurants for the last 15 years. Known for his polite and respectful demeanor, James was a quiet but kind soul who always had a smile on his face. James had a deep love for the outdoors, spending countless hours fishing, working in the yard, and going on walks. He enjoyed watching boxing, drinking beer, and playing pool and darts with his longtime friends. His passion for playing chess was matched only by the joy he found in spending time with his many friends and family members. He is survived by his children, James Michael Mason III (33) of Columbus, Ohio, Jaimie Michelle Mason (31) of Columbus, Ohio, and Shaelynn Kaylee Delilah Mason (9) of Bucyrus, Ohio. James is also survived by his siblings, Michelle (Victor) Floyd, Maurice Mason, Moishi Mason, Dimitri (Stacy) Mason, and Nyota Mason, as well as his many beloved cousins from the SUM/Jones Family and numerous nieces and nephews. James was preceded in death by his ex-wife and lifelong friend, Cindy Brewer Mason, and his brothers, Richard Torn Mason and Alex Mason. James will be remembered for his warm heart, gentle nature, and the joy he brought to those around him. His legacy of kindness and love will continue to live on in the hearts of his family and friends. A service and celebration of life will be held at Mayes Community Temple, 801 Bennett Street. James Michael Mason Jr.'s memory will forever be a guiding light to those who knew and loved him.
